Oct 7, 2025

Routine

Score: 911 violation

6-1D - time as a public health control: procedures and records

Regulation: 511-6-1.04(6)(i) - time as a public health control (tphc) (p, pf, c)

9 ptsCorrected: YesRepeat: No

Observed cut, leafy greens in front service area out of temperature, PIC informed that they were being held as TPHC. Date marking stickers noted discard time as EOD.

CA: The food shall be marked or otherwise identified to indicate the time that is 4 hours past the point in time when the food is removed from temperature control.

COS: PIC and staff re-labeled TPHC cut leafy greens discard time as 2pm based on stated prep work start time of 10am.

Apr 8, 2024

Routine

Score: 852 violations

6-1C - proper cooling time and temperature

Regulation: 511-6-1.04(6)(d) - cooling (p)

9 ptsCorrected: YesRepeat: No

Observed cooked pickled onions that did not cool from 135F to 70F within 2 hours. Onions cooked at 10am and inspector temped around 1:45pm. COS: cooked pickled onions discarded. Gave Just Cool It poster.

4-2B - food-contact surfaces: cleaned & sanitized

Regulation: 511-6-1.05(7)(b) - food contact surfaces and utensils - cleaning frequency (p, c)

4 ptsCorrected: YesRepeat: Yes

Observed bowl of raw chicken at the designated produce sink. Raw chicken and other raw animal products shall be prepared in an area that reduces the risk of contamination such as a designated meat sink. Produce sink shall be washed, rinsed and sanitized before next use. COS: Raw chicken relocated to meat sink and produce sink washed, rinsed and sanitized.
